Keto Pan Seared Salmon

Elevate your keto dinner game with this luscious Keto Pan Seared Salmon, a quick and elegant dish packed with flavor and healthy fats. Perfectly seared to achieve a crispy skin and tender, flaky interior, these salmon fillets are seasoned with a simple blend of sea salt, garlic powder, and black pepper, then finished with a rich lemon-dill butter sauce that’s downright irresistible. With just 10 minutes of prep and 15 minutes of cook time, this low-carb recipe is ideal for busy weeknights or as a show-stopping centerpiece for guests. Pair it with roasted vegetables or a fresh green salad to keep it keto-friendly and deliciously satisfying!

Prep Time:10 mins
Cook Time:15 mins
Total Time:25 mins
Servings: 4

Ingredients

  • 4 pieces salmon fillets
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ons butter
  • 1 whole lemon
  • 1 tablespoon fresh dill
  • 0.5 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 0.5 teaspoon sea salt
  • 0.25 teaspoon black pepper

Directions

Step 1

Take the salmon fillets out of the refrigerator and let them sit at room temperature for about 10 minutes before cooking.

Step 2

Pat dry the salmon fillets with paper towels to remove excess moisture. This will help achieve a crispy skin.

Step 3

Season the fillets on both sides with sea salt, black pepper, and garlic powder.

Step 4

He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a non-stick skillet over medium-high heat. Once hot, add 1 tablespoon of butter and swirl it around the pan.

Step 5

Place the salmon fillets skin-side down in the pan. Cook for about 4-5 minutes, pressing gently with a spatula to ensure even contact with the pan.

Step 6

Flip the fillets carefully and cook for another 3-4 minutes, or until the middle of the salmon is slightly translucent and the flesh flakes easily with a fork.

Step 7

Squeeze half of the lemon over the salmon fillets while they are in the pan.

Step 8

Remove the salmon from the pan and set aside. Add another tablespoon of butter and olive oil to the skillet, then stir in the fresh dill and the juice of the remaining half lemon.

Step 9

Turn off the heat and spoon the lemon-dill butter sauce over the salmon fillets.

Step 10

Serve immediately, garnished with extra dill or lemon wedges if desired.
